‘Azadi Ka Amrit Mahotsava’ celebratio­ns at US Capitol

-

COMMEMORAT­ING the 75th anniversar­y of India's Independen­ce, 75 Indian-American organizati­ons have announced to celebrate the ‘Azadi Ka Amrit Mahotsava' at US Capitol from September 14.

‘This unique US Capitol event will be a hallmark in the festivity of India's independen­ce, bringing 75 organizati­ons together and showcasing India's unique culture and diversity,' Jashvant Patel, CEO, US-India Relationsh­ip Council and chairman of the organizing Committee, said.

‘The Indian diaspora organizati­ons will use this opportunit­y to remember India's rich tradition, its heroes, people, and their achievemen­ts,' said Patel who is also the president of Sardar Patel Fund for Sanatan Sanskruti.

The Indian-American community has significan­tly contribute­d to the US in the past 75 years. The achievemen­ts include advancemen­ts in healthcare, technology, human rights, sustainabi­lity, and environmen­tal health, among others, the organizers said in a statement.

Innovation is at the forefront, and the US and India - the oldest and largest democracie­s - have worked together to further the relationsh­ip in many areas, it said.

Ashok Bhatt, former Water Commission­er, California and vice chair of the organizing committee said India's Ambassador of India to the United States, Taranjit Singh Sandhu will be the guest of honor at Capitol Hill. Several Congressme­n are expected to attend the event.
